Output 40abe83e7f26f8b60bdf84eeecf877007ba4c9fd25adbc004b4e4d91fdd4f8ea:0

value
109628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3668895844790c88656f0af38ddafdca88e3fef0 OP_EQUAL
address
36eheE55WozBgGqK9NzrsTwuUTdpcx7VLT
transaction
40abe83e7f26f8b60bdf84eeecf877007ba4c9fd25adbc004b4e4d91fdd4f8ea
confirmations
68329
spent
true